• Press or tap Start/Pause to stop the washing machine.
• It may take a few moments for the door lock mechanism to
disengage.
• The door will not open until 3 minutes after the washing
machine has stopped or the power has been off.
• Make sure all the water in the drum is drained.
• The door may not open if water remains in the drum. Drain the
drum and open the door manually.
• Make sure the door lock light is off. The door lock light turns
off after the washing machine has drained.
• Make sure you use the recommended types of detergent as
appropriate.
• Use high efficiency (HE) detergent to prevent oversudsing.
• Reduce the detergent amount for soft water, small loads, or
lightly soiled loads.
• Non-HE detergent is not recommended.
• Make sure the remaining amount of detergent and fabric
softener is not over the limit.
• Plug the power cord into a live electrical outlet.
• Check the fuse or reset the circuit breaker.
• Close the door and press or tap Start/Pause to start the
washing machine.
For your safety, the washing machine will not tumble or spin
unless the door is closed.
• Before the washing machine starts to fill, it will make a series
of clicking noises to check the door lock and will do quick
drain.
• There may be a pause or soak period in the cycle. Wait briefly,
and the washing machine may start.
• Make sure the mesh filter of the water supply hose at the
water taps is not clogged. Periodically clean the mesh filter.
• If the washing machine is not supplied with sufficient power,
the washing machine will temporarily not drain or spin. As
soon as the washing machine regains sufficient power, it will
operate normally.
